Output 51ebf2a9a4033bab1878936f1f95ec98c80056ae37ec9e81f7cf7d3d1bfe5c92:11

value
9862535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d30b5b33becbdd8d42ad9cf441e26ed790eb7deb OP_EQUAL
address
3Lvv74pQdXCG5gF1BR2FMtQpzXexnocBGT
transaction
51ebf2a9a4033bab1878936f1f95ec98c80056ae37ec9e81f7cf7d3d1bfe5c92
spent
true